How much do golf course hiring j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 24, 2026, the average hourly pay for golf course hiring in Maple Ridge, BC is $17.93,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.06 and $20.61 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Do golf cart girls make good money?

Golf course staff who work as cart girls typically earn an hourly wage, often supplemented by tips from golfers. Their total earnings can vary based on location, hours worked, and customer generosity, but tips usually make up a significant portion of their income. Many find the pay adequate for part-time or seasonal work, especially when tips are included.

Can I make money working at a golf course?

Golf course jobs such as groundskeepers, caddies, and staff typically offer hourly wages or salaries, which can provide a steady income. Earnings vary based on position, experience, and location, with some roles offering tips or bonuses, especially for caddies. Many positions are seasonal or part-time, affecting overall income potential.

How to get a job working for the PGA?

To work for the PGA, candidates should pursue relevant roles such as golf operations, coaching, or administrative positions, often requiring experience in golf or sports management. Certifications like PGA Professional status or related credentials can improve chances, and networking within the golf industry is also beneficial.

What jobs in golf pay well?

In golf, the highest-paying roles typically include golf course superintendents, head golf professionals, and general managers, with salaries often exceeding $70,000 annually. These positions require experience, certifications, and strong leadership skills, and they often involve managing operations, staff, and course maintenance. Other well-paying roles may include golf instructors with specialized skills or those working at exclusive clubs.

Golf Course Turf Maintenance (Seasonal)

Marine Drive Golf Club

Vancouver, BC • On-site

Full-time

Posted 29 days ago


Job description

Salary: $23.74 per hour

The MDGC Experience

Do you enjoy working outside and being part of a great team? Marine Drive Golf Club is one of the top private golf clubs in Western Canada. Located only 20 minutes from downtown (near Southlands and Kerrisdale), it boasts some of the best course conditions in Vancouver. We strive to make everyones playing and working experience exceptional by following our Core Values of Excellence, Passion, Integrity and Coachability.


Responsibilities:

  • Maintaining all areas of the golf course, including mowing, trimming turf, maintaining bunkers and other assigned tasks
  • Positive attitude towards your fellow turf-maintenance team members and Club members
  • Effective communication and cooperation with supervisors daily

Wages & Hours of Work:

  • Earn up to $23.74/hour (base rate is $21.74/hour + 2 dollar/hour seasonal retention incentive) + benefits
  • Shifts start as early as 5:00 AM or 5:30 AM
  • Working 32 - 38 hours per week


Qualifications:

  • Experience working outdoors (i.e. golf courses, landscaping or manual labour) is an asset
  • Previous experience using hand tools or equipment is preferred
  • Have a positive attitude and be a team player
  • Enjoy working early mornings and being done early
  • Sustain prolonged periods of walking, standing, bending, stretching, pushing, pulling, climbing ladders, or kneeling
  • Physically able to operate power equipment
  • Ability to occasionally lift to 50 lbs is desirable, but not essential
  • Possessing a drivers license is preferred


Additional Information:

  • Must be able to work in a variety of weather conditions
  • All on-site training provided
  • Golf shirts, work gloves, and footwear allowance provided
  • Golf can occasionally be arranged at appropriate times through a supervisor


Benefits:

  • Team & company-wide events
  • Health Benefits
  • On-site parking
  • Limited golf privileges
